Invitation to tender 01B46-25-014
Request for an offer to purchase – Sale of Standing Forage Crops
Tenders for the project indicated above will be accepted at the following email address: aafc.escprocurement-cseapprovisionnement.aac@agr.gc.ca, up to the tender closing date and time indicated below:
Tender Period Closing Date and Time: June 3, 2025 at 2:00 pm (Eastern Daylight Time).
Scope of Work:
The St. John’s Research and Development Centre of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ada (AAFC) located in Bldg 5, at 204 Brookfield Road St John’s, NL A1E 6J5, require obtaining offers to perform forage and grain harvesting on its farm for the 2025 season.
Site Visit:
It is strongly recommended that the Bidder or a representative of the Bidder visit the work site. Arrangements have been made for a tour of the work site. The site visit will be held on May 22, 2025 at 9:30 AM Newfoundland Daylight Saving Time, at the St. John’s Research and Development Centre BLDG. 5, 204 Brookfield Road St-John’s, NL A1E 6J5.
Attendance to this visit is NOT MANDATORY but Firms that do not attend will not be given an alternative appointment, although they will not be precluded from submitting an offer. Any clarifications or changes to the bid solicitation resulting from the site visit will be included as an amendment to the bid solicitation and will be posted on CanadaBuys.
Information requests and inquiries related to this tender process are to be directed, in writing, ONLY to the AAFC Contract Officer identified below. Bidders who contact anyone other than the AAFC Contract Officer to obtain such information during the solicitation period may, for that reason alone, be disqualified.
It is MANDATORY for the Firms intending to submit tenders on this project to obtain the related specifications, plans and drawings, and all other tender documents through the CanadaBuys service provider. Addenda, when issued, will be available from the CanadaBuys service provider.
AAFC reserves the right to accept any Proposal in whole or in part, without prior negotiation and reject any or all Proposals received.
